Why does being a feminist have a negative connotation?
One of the methods of keeping a certain social set under submission is to discredit them. Isn't this evident in the association by many people, especially men, of negative characteristics with the term feminist and the role of the feminist in society?

Simply put, because not enough men are feminist. When you are in a male dominated society, a concept is not acceptable or positive unless it is approved by the mainstream or those who "have the power." Take the word "Gossip" for example. It was not negative until men wondered what the heck all the women could be talking about as they helped another woman deliver a baby. Something mischievous just had to be occurring.
one problem some feminists have , a minority, is that they reverse discriminate and truly dislike or hate men. This very small minority may be some of the reason for the negative connotation - maybe. Overall however, I think that people resist change and men have been the ones in control for most of history. There will be growing pains along the way. I don't believe feminists are going to be stopped ever - and that's a good thing. I consider myself a feminist. I also believe in fairness however and that women and men should be equal, not that we should start tearing men down. Have you noticed a lot of commercials for example geared to women make men appear stupid? we cringe when looking back on women being depicted as shallow and dumb, but it's perfectly acceptable it seems now to do the same in reverse - that's where I think "feminism" has some challenges. Two wrongs don't make a right. Feminists should focus on being strong, empowered women in their own right - not in tearing men down.
